Copper Creek Announces New Director
Nov 13, 2017
Surge Battery Metals
7 min read
VANCOUVER, BRITISH COLUMBIA – November 13, 2017 – Copper Creek Gold Corp. (the “Company”) announces the appointment of Tim Fernback as a director of the Company in place of David Gerstner. Tim Fernback has held multiple senior executive positions, including oversight of the Investment Banking and Corporate Finance Divisions at Wolverton Securities, formerly Western Canada’s oldest brokerage firm.
Tim Fernback currently serves as a Director for several Canadian mining companies. He holds an Honours B.Sc. from McMaster University, and is a graduate of the Sauder School of Business at the University of British Columbia, where he completed a MBA with a concentration in Finance. Tim Fernback holds a Certified Professional Accounting Designation (CPA, CMA).
The board thanks Mr. Gerstner for his contributions to the Company and wishes him success in his future endeavors.
About Copper Creek Gold:
The Company is a Canadian‐based mineral exploration company which has been active in the resource sector in British Columbia and elsewhere in Western Canada.
